Scope
This Recommendation describes radiodetermination radar systems antenna patterns to be used for singleentry and aggregate interference analysis. Given knowledge about antenna 3 dB beamwidth and first peak side-lobe level, the proper set of equations for bothazimuth and elevation patterns may be selected. Both peak, for single interferer, and average patterns, for multiple interferers, are defined.
